Проект "Свободные голосования"

Электронная системы голосований через интернет
Текущее время: 29 мар 2024, 09:02

Часовой пояс: UTC + 3 часа [ Летнее время ]




Начать новую тему Ответить на тему  [ Сообщений: 24 ]  На страницу Пред.  1, 2, 3
Автор Сообщение
СообщениеДобавлено: 10 мар 2012, 23:29 
Не в сети

Зарегистрирован: 24 сен 2011, 23:06
Сообщения: 395
Тут на самом деле обсуждался метод поиска узлов по имеющемуся идентификатору или поиска узлов имеющих некоторую информацию. Для уже присоединённого к сети узла.

На самом деле это и есть прямое назначение DHT.

При первичном ("холодном") запуске нужно будет обратиться на публичную точку присоединения или ввести адрес известного и работающего узла.
Публичная точка присоединения это обычный узел сети имеющий доменное имя. Таких узлов может быть много.
Работающий же узел может быть любым. Скажем друга или свой собственный на другой машине.

Основной смысл "или" в том чтобы не было потребности в мощном сервере для публичной точки присоединения. Условно говоря публичная точка присоединения имеет возможность обработать n запросов за некоторое время. Обработка запроса на присоединение возможно будет занимать продолжительное время. Узлу нужно будет запросить информацию по ЭП владельца присоединяющего узла. Мы ведь не хотим чтобы кто-либо имел возможность положить сеть фейковыми узлами.

Соответственно при холодном подключении узел должен сообщить подключающему узлу ЭП владельца. И получить тикет "запрос возможно будет обработан через x часов тикет действителен y дней". Придя через x часов узел получит или продление тикета, или информацию для подключения с сертификатом подписанным подключающим узлом. В информации для подключения будет список IP через которые уже можно осуществить горячее подключение.

Не желающие ждать продолжительное время могут сделать запрос на личный узел который будет выполнять только этот один запрос. В случае если ЭП владельца подключаемого узла совпадает с ЭП владельца подключающего узла, то он просто подписывает сертификат и делится списком известных ему адресов.

Это "холодное" подключение.

П.С.: возможно с сертификатами я перебарщиваю, но на данный момент так видится правильней.

_________________
Во вселенной нет общества в котором "Vox populi, vox Dei" не переводилось бы "О, Боже, как мы в это вляпались".


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 10 мар 2012, 23:50 
Не в сети
Аватара пользователя

Зарегистрирован: 24 фев 2012, 15:41
Сообщения: 45
Откуда: Украина, Днепропетровск
Не совсем понял, эта схема поиска работает до авторизации или только после авторизации пользователя? Если до, то какой ЭП отдавать если на машине несколько пользователей (допустим в семье один компьютер). Если после авторизации, то как создается ЭП и сообщается о нем в сети? Или возможно я что-то не так понял.


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 11 мар 2012, 00:09 
Не в сети

Зарегистрирован: 24 сен 2011, 23:06
Сообщения: 395
Oleg писал(а):
Не совсем понял, эта схема поиска работает до авторизации или только после авторизации пользователя? Если до, то какой ЭП отдавать если на машине несколько пользователей (допустим в семье один компьютер). Если после авторизации, то как создается ЭП и сообщается о нем в сети? Или возможно я что-то не так понял.
До авторизации. В начальный момент ЭП подписан только самим владельцем. По сути подключающий узел ставит на нём и свою подпись придавая некоторый вес этому документу. Допустим при подтверждении мыла. Или личного знакомства. (Что кстати более весомо.)

Формально имея на компьютере несколько ЭП разных лиц для сети этот узел имеет только одного владельца. При нарушениях санкции будут применяться к владельцу. Ещё раз процитирую Бисмарка. "Для успеха необходимо чтобы за одно конкретное дело отвечал один конкретный человек." Естественно под блокировку попадут все кто на данном компе. Но минусы будут в "карме" только формального владельца.

_________________
Во вселенной нет общества в котором "Vox populi, vox Dei" не переводилось бы "О, Боже, как мы в это вляпались".


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 11 мар 2012, 00:17 
Не в сети
Аватара пользователя

Зарегистрирован: 24 фев 2012, 15:41
Сообщения: 45
Откуда: Украина, Днепропетровск
Примерно понял. Согласен по поводу нескольких ЭП: если нашкодничали "дети", то виноват "папа" :)


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 24 ]  На страницу Пред.  1, 2, 3

Часовой пояс: UTC + 3 часа [ Летнее время ]


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 1


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B® Forum Software © phpBB Group
Русская поддержка phpBB